The formula for converting the Pebibytes per Second (PiBps) to Exabits per Minute (Ebit/Min) can be expressed as follows:

diamond CONVERSION FORMULA Ebit/Min = PiBps x (8x10245) ÷ 10006 x 60

Now, let's apply the aforementioned formula and explore the manual conversion process from Pebibytes per Second (PiBps) to Exabits per Minute (Ebit/Min). To streamline the calculation further, we can simplify the formula for added convenience.

FORMULA

Exabits per Minute = Pebibytes per Second x (8x10245) ÷ 10006 x 60

STEP 1

Exabits per Minute = Pebibytes per Second x (8x1024x1024x1024x1024x1024) ÷ (1000x1000x1000x1000x1000x1000) x 60

STEP 2

Exabits per Minute = Pebibytes per Second x 9007199254740992 ÷ 1000000000000000000 x 60

STEP 3

Exabits per Minute = Pebibytes per Second x 0.009007199254740992 x 60

STEP 4

Exabits per Minute = Pebibytes per Second x 0.54043195528445952

Unit Definitions

What is Pebibyte ?

A Pebibyte (PiB) is a binary unit of digital information that is equal to 1,125,899,906,842,624 bytes (or 9,007,199,254,740,992 bits) and is defined by the International Electro technical Commission(IEC). The prefix 'pebi' is derived from the binary number system and it is used to distinguish it from the decimal-based 'petabyte' (PB). It is widely used in the field of computing as it more accurately represents the storage size of high end servers and data storage arrays.

What is Exabit ?

An Exabit (Eb or Ebit) is a decimal unit of measurement for digital information transfer rate. It is equal to 1,000,000,000,000,000,000 (one quintillion) bits. It is used to measure the speed of extremely high-speed data transfer over communication networks, such as high-speed internet backbones and advanced computer networks.
